ethers-flashbots 0.15.0

Flashbots middleware for ethers-rs

use ethers::core::{rand::thread_rng, types::transaction::eip2718::TypedTransaction};
use ethers::prelude::*;
use ethers_flashbots::*;
use eyre::Result;
use std::convert::TryFrom;
use url::Url;

// See https://www.mev.to/builders for up to date builder URLs
static BUILDER_URLS: &[&str] = &[
    "https://builder0x69.io",
    "https://rpc.beaverbuild.org",
    "https://relay.flashbots.net",
    "https://rsync-builder.xyz",
    "https://rpc.titanbuilder.xyz",
    "https://api.blocknative.com/v1/auction",
    "https://mev.api.blxrbdn.com",
    "https://eth-builder.com",
    "https://builder.gmbit.co/rpc",
    "https://buildai.net",
    "https://rpc.payload.de",
    "https://rpc.lightspeedbuilder.info",
    "https://rpc.nfactorial.xyz",
    "https://rpc.lokibuilder.xyz",
];

#[tokio::main]
async fn main() -> Result<()> {
    // Connect to the network
    let provider = Provider::<Http>::try_from("https://mainnet.eth.aragon.network")?;

    // This is your searcher identity
    let bundle_signer = LocalWallet::new(&mut thread_rng());
    // This signs transactions
    let wallet = LocalWallet::new(&mut thread_rng());

    // Add signer and Flashbots middleware
    let client = SignerMiddleware::new(
        BroadcasterMiddleware::new(
            provider,
            BUILDER_URLS
                .iter()
                .map(|url| Url::parse(url).unwrap())
                .collect(),
            Url::parse("https://relay.flashbots.net")?,
            bundle_signer,
        ),
        wallet,
    );

    // get last block number
    let block_number = client.get_block_number().await?;

    // Build a custom bundle that pays 0x0000000000000000000000000000000000000000
    let tx = {
        let mut inner: TypedTransaction = TransactionRequest::pay(Address::zero(), 100).into();
        client.fill_transaction(&mut inner, None).await?;
        inner
    };
    let signature = client.signer().sign_transaction(&tx).await?;
    let bundle = BundleRequest::new()
        .push_transaction(tx.rlp_signed(&signature))
        .set_block(block_number + 1)
        .set_simulation_block(block_number)
        .set_simulation_timestamp(0);

    // Send it
    let results = client.inner().send_bundle(&bundle).await?;

    // You can also optionally wait to see if the bundle was included
    for result in results {
        match result {
            Ok(pending_bundle) => match pending_bundle.await {
                Ok(bundle_hash) => println!(
                    "Bundle with hash {:?} was included in target block",
                    bundle_hash
                ),
                Err(PendingBundleError::BundleNotIncluded) => {
                    println!("Bundle was not included in target block.")
                }
                Err(e) => println!("An error occured: {}", e),
            },
            Err(e) => println!("An error occured: {}", e),
        }
    }

    Ok(())
}
